bpo-31900: Fix localeconv() encoding for LC_NUMERIC by vstinner · Pull Request #4174 · python/cpython

@vstinner

* Add _Py_GetLocaleconvNumeric() function: decode decimal_point and
  thousands_sep fields of localeconv() from the LC_NUMERIC encoding,
  rather than decoding from the LC_CTYPE encoding.
* Modify locale.localeconv() and "n" formatter of str.format() (for
  int, float and complex to use _Py_GetLocaleconvNumeric()
  internally.

@vstinner

The setlocale() is only done in a rare use case (LC_NUMERIC and
LC_CTYPE have a different encoding), it's safe to call localeconv()
in all other cases.
